A work breakdown structure WBS is what helps managers break down each step of their projects and consider all tasks to achieve the final results. A deliverable-oriented hierarchical decomposition of the work to be executed by the project team to accomplish the project objectives and create the required deliverables.

The Project Management Institute PMI defines work breakdown structure as a hierarchical decomposition of the total scope of work to be carried out by the project team to accomplish the project objectives and create the required deliverables. A work breakdown structure can be formatted in various ways including as an outline basically a numbered list a hierarchical table or a tree diagram. The most common method for defining a WBS is the outlining method in which tasks are defined using a hierarchical structure and numbered using common outlining such as 1 11 12 121 122 etc. It is a prescribed method of breaking down large or complex. Regardless of format a WBS will typically include outline numbering to represent the sequential order of each level and activity.

Work breakdown structure WBS codes are outline numbers that you can apply to tasks and edit to match the specific needs of your business.
